Handover note — Pondermill connection pooling

Welcome aboard. The Pondermill API uses a shared pool capped at 40 connections per replica; the cap lives in pool.yaml, not the env vars, which trips people up. If you see checkout timeouts, check replica count before raising the cap. Metrics are on the Driftboard dashboard under "db-pool." For pooling questions or changes, the owner going forward is listed directly below.

account owner for kafop-haweg: Pelax Gilael Istir

## Deployment — Offline Mode

FieldNoter's offline mode ships as part of the standard build, so there's no separate package to install. When a device loses signal, surveys queue locally and sync once connectivity returns — support folks, this is why "missing" entries usually show up a few hours later. Sync behavior is controlled server-side, and the current deployment uses the following configuration values.

settings of tagef-bawif:
DRUIX_HOST=druix.zemvarlabs.internal
DRUIX_PORT=8000

## Changelog — Stormline Fan-Out v4.2

Changed defaults: weather-alert fan-out now batches per county instead of per station, and the retry window dropped from 120s to 45s. This cut duplicate pushes during the Kelbrook Valley flood drills. Queue partitioning is unchanged. The full set of active defaults shipped with this release is listed below.

service settings:
novath:
  pin: 1396
  tenant: pelys
  seal: seal_ccc035e1
  metrics_host: metrics.novath.qorvelworks.test
  standby_team: fraeth
  escalation: drueth-zorok
  nonce: 61d508